Fence Painting Service in Waco, TX
Fence painting services involve applying fresh coats of paint or stain to enhance the appearance and protect wooden, vinyl, or metal fences. This service covers a variety of projects, including updating the look of existing fences, restoring weathered surfaces, or preparing fences for new landscaping or property improvements. Homeowners often seek fence painting to improve curb appeal, increase privacy, or add a layer of protection against the elements, making it important to understand the type of fence material, current condition, and desired finish before requesting service.
Property owners typically want to know about the preparation process, such as cleaning and surface treatment, to ensure the paint adheres properly and lasts longer. It’s also helpful to consider the type of paint or stain used, as different finishes offer varying levels of durability and appearance. Clarifying the scope of work, including whether any repairs or sanding are included, can help homeowners make informed decisions and achieve the best results for their fencing project.

Fence Painting Service Questions
What types of fences can be painted? Fence painting services typically cover wood, vinyl, aluminum, and chain-link fences to enhance durability and appearance.
How often should a fence be repainted? Repainting is generally recommended every 3 to 5 years to maintain protection and appearance.
What preparations are needed before painting a fence? Surfaces should be cleaned, stripped of old paint if necessary, and repaired to ensure a smooth, even finish.
Are different paint types used for various fence materials? Yes, specific paints are chosen based on the fence material to ensure proper adhesion and weather resistance.
